I finely got the people from cub cadet to look at my tractor. They agreed that there is a problem and put in a heaver spring in the detent and all so added metal plates on top of the plastic that shows what gear it is in, looks preaty cheasy. They said that they are going to change the design of this part and send me a new one we will see!!!!
There was also a problem with the motor not running smoothly. It was the coils loosened up. Reajusted them and tighten them runs great now.

I had a 7254 back 3 years ago, paid too much, at the time I thought that all the creature comforts would be great! BUT at 25 hours I knew I had bought the wrong tractor. At 50 hrs the digital dash panel blew, warranteed, no prob, $800. Had continuous problems with the switches for the pto, again warranteed. Pto shaft was missing a spacer, hydrolic leaks out, warranteed no prob. The on demand 4wd is a joke, as soon as you need it, it comes on so strong you dig in. Winter starting forget it, need to get hydrolic oil heater to get it going, keep in mind this is a gas engine. Hydrostatic wine, too loud, too light wt to do real work. Bolts all over needed to be retourqed. Anyway I learned alot and sold it at 350 hrs, if someone has a nice yard to mow, and move some mulch, crushed rock, etc this small tractor will perform, just didnt meet my requirements. I now have an 870jd which is alot more tractor for less money and has the same hours.
